1. Preserve More of Your Natural Tooth

In traditional dentistry, the drill often removes healthy tooth structure to “make room” for a filling or crown. Adhesive dentistry takes a different route. We use a highly precise, tooth-conserving techniques to target only the damaged areas – preserving your enamel and bonding directly to the tooth for strength and durability.

2. Less Pain = Less Anxiety

The drill isn’t just loud – it is often painful and requires anesthesia. With our technique we drill less, and we use sophisticated anesthesia techniques which are less painful. Many patients report little to no discomfort during their procedures.

3. Bonded For Strength, Not Cut to Fit

Unlike traditional fillings that rely on mechanical retention, adhesive restorations are bonded directly to the tooth. They are properly done will require less tooth drilling and will reinforce the natural structure.

4. Minimize Future Dental Work

By preserving more of your teeth and using bonding techniques, your dental future is brighter. As more of the tooth is preserved, the tooth is better able to handle future problems, thus you keep your natural teeth.  That’s better for your health – and your wallet.
